Here's a good list of stuff for a 12 I've come up with. Lots of it I have had in one of mine.
Frogs-
Bullfrogs, pacmans, tomatoes, darts, African clawed(fill it up a little with water) lots of toad species
Snakes-
Kenyan sand boas, mountain kingsnakes, smaller milksnakes, shovelnose snakes, rosy boa
Lizards-
Geckos-
Knobtail, banded, panther, velvet, dune, webfoot, clawed, frogeyed
Others-
Whiptails, side blotches, small skink species, curlytails, swift species, small armadillo lizard species, anoles, Pygmy leaf chameleons, fire skink, schneiders skink

As far as geckos go you can keep mostly any of them from leopard geckos to viper geckos. I would a the larger species like tokays, giant day geckos, and obviously leachies. I personally would recommend crested geckos. Easy to maintain, no additional heat, no live food needed, and you can keep in a beautiful vivarium with live plants.

For snakes you could do garters, sand boas, hog noses, and juveniles of most other snake species if you're willing to upgrade.

You could also keep many many kinds of amphibians. Various salamanders, tree frogs, dart frogs, toads, ect. I would also recommend trying a live vivarium with any of these guys too.

It might seem like a lot if work to do a live vivarium but once you got it setup it pretty much takes care of its self, you just add food and water and spot clean as needed.
